The Company

About Jn Bentley

-In the mid‑1970s it expanded into general building, then turned to pipelines and pumping stations in the 1980s. -By the 1990s its civil‑engineering focus deepened, culminating in the 1999 launch of a major JV partnership. -Typical projects span water infrastructure, hydroelectric power, industrial buildings, highways and coastal works. -Clients include major water companies, Environment Agency, Canal & River Trust, Rolls‑Royce, P&G and Associated British Ports. -The 2013 merger with JBA Consulting formed a new entity offering integrated low‑carbon environmental solutions.
